Igor Krivokapič (born 1965) is a Slovenian editor, composer and music educator.

Biography
Igor Krivokapič studied at Academy of Music and New England Conservatory. Training under Malcolm Peyton is recorded. The recorded working language is Slovene. Subjects and genres recorded for the work are classical music.
